North Korean troops are in Russia, protection secretary says

Secretary of Defense Lloyd Austin stated North Korea has deployed troops to Russia, the primary senior US official to verify the event on the report, as North Korea and Russia have solid more and more pleasant ties since Moscow’s invasion of Ukraine. #CNN #News